#a25686 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a25686 is composed of 63.5% red, 33.7%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 17.3%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 322.1 degrees, a saturation of 30.6% and a lightness of 48.6%. #a25686 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#45000d.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#a25686

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080407 is the darkest color, while #fdfaf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a25686

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85737e is the less saturated color, while #f8009d is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a25686 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#727272 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7c6c76 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6c759a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#7a7486 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a3656c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7f6a93 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#886986 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a25f75 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
